Job’s Not Done

person writing on a notebook beside macbook

Stay on your toes

The job’s never done. We are never fully satisfied.

But that’s a good thing.

To be satisfied is to be complacent. It’s to rest on your laurels.

Not completing the job keeps you busy. It keeps you going.

The job’s not done. But that’s not a bad thing.
